Output 3de8ca853627bf93036e367b1349b12e652af164881a1966d49e26acad6ab66c:30

value
14686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f91e4cf37774246a37ef7254fbf084f3e25bfe95df155a876a970f6fd3dfb7d3
address
bc1ply0yeumhwsjx5dl0wf20huyy7039hl54mu244pm2ju8kl57lklfsd5ha96
transaction
3de8ca853627bf93036e367b1349b12e652af164881a1966d49e26acad6ab66c
spent
true